Comfort

Take into consideration how you will use the treadmill before shopping. If you are primarily using it for walking and walking, you can save money by purchasing an older model that has a variety of built-in workout programs that are designed to improve your fitness performance. If you plan to run or sprint then you should choose a model with higher speeds and the incline levels.

The top treadmills we tested have many smart features. They include footage from real-life from mountains and trails and augmented reality training trails and virtual coaches. These features can aid in monitoring and adjusting your exercise routine to improve your fitness over time.

A good treadmill will provide a variety of workout options to keep your workout interesting and challenging, along with the ability to easily connect to your smartphone to download a new session from an app or other streaming service. These features can make a difference between a treadmill you like and one you avoid.

If you're a beginner you should consider treadmills that have an integrated running program that comes with pre-programmed interval training. These workouts were created by certified personal training professionals and can help you improve your fitness over time. They also help you save time since they do not require manual adjustments.

For experienced runners, a treadmill at home with the capability of replicating steep hills or other outdoor terrain is the best choice to provide a more realistic workout. To accomplish this, you'll need to ensure that your treadmill can handle an incline maximum of at least 10% and has a peak speed that is fast enough for your desired pace.

A good treadmill should have a simple user interface that you can operate using the large display screen that is on the machine as well as buttons. It should also come with an safety feature that can instantly stop your workout in the event that you get off balance or fall off. Noelle McKenzie, an ACE-certified functional trainer, regards safety as the most important aspect of treadmills. She also seeks a belt that has adequate padding, rails, and a safety lock to ensure safety in the event that the user ever falls off the treadmill.

Other factors to think about when choosing the best treadmill include its shock absorption as well as the length of its running deck is. A belt of 50 inches long is ideal for walkers, while runners need a deck at least 60 inches to accommodate their longer strides. Some treadmills have a deck that is even bigger than those dimensions, but they tend to cost more.

Treadmills run on manual or electric motors. Motorized treadmills are the most popular and offer more features than manual ones that include adjustable inclines and various speeds. However, if you're planning to do high-intensity interval workouts you might require a treadmill with a higher-powered motor. It should be rated at least 3.0 continuous horsepower.

The best treadmills have a long warranty that includes both labor and parts. Some treadmills have shorter warranties. Some are only covered for the first year or so of use. Be sure to read the terms and conditions before purchasing. Find out if moving parts, such as the frame and motor are covered under warranty. The industry standard is 10 to lifetime warranties on the motors and frames, but other parts are often only covered for one or two years.
